Tööstusharudesse is a general term referring to various sectors of industry or economic activity. In a national or regional context, it encompasses the diverse range of businesses and enterprises that contribute to the production of goods and services. These sectors can be broadly categorized, often as primary (extraction of raw materials), secondary (manufacturing and processing), and tertiary (services). Each tööstusharu has its own unique characteristics, technological requirements, and economic significance. Understanding the structure and interplay of different tööstusharudesse is crucial for economic analysis, policy-making, and strategic business planning. For instance, a country might focus on developing its heavy industry, such as manufacturing and construction, or it might prioritize its service sector, including finance, tourism, and technology. The distribution of resources, labor, and investment across these various tööstusharudesse shapes the overall economic landscape and the nation's competitive position in the global market.
